Transaction da3433000c95520f2937c131ef86cfdca66f6e981ee3669364469791600105bc
1 Input
1 Output
-
da3433000c95520f2937c131ef86cfdca66f6e981ee3669364469791600105bc:0
- value
- 11028123
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52a10672d8727588650f4a665de7cb5cd896fa4b OP_EQUAL
- address
- 39DvEVxsr3ttAXmQCAcyCz2Lxq5GyqmyKV